How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Green Island?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Green Island Studio Apartments | $1,418 | $915 | $1,900 |
| Green Island 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,619 | $750 | $2,225 |
| Green Island 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,913 | $1,100 | $3,880 |
| Green Island 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,618 | $750 | $3,840 |
| Green Island 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,650 | $974 | $3,635 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Green Island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Green Island with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Green Island is at The Delaware listed at $895.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Green Island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Green Island is $1,619.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Green Island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Green Island is a 1,020 square feet unit starting from $1,804 at The Lofts at Harmony Mills.
What is the average size for Green Island 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Green Island is currently 446 sq ft.
